How many significant figures in 11 soccer players
maria [59]
Counting gives an exact number and exact numbers have infinite sig figs.

any time an energy conversion takes place, some of the original energy is converted to which one of the following?
Charra [1.4K]

Answer:

Thermal energy.

Explanation:

Anytime energy transfers between 2 places or things some of it is 'wasted' as thermal energy (heat). This could be by friction or a change in temperature from a reaction. We say it is wasted because this heat energy serves no purpose.
